The trouble under your feet, in the walls, and behind the fridge

Pest troubles come under 3 pails. Structural pests, such as termites, carpenter ants, and powderpost beetles, endanger the structure itself. Sanitation parasites, such as cockroaches, flies, and rodents, grow on food sources and moisture. Periodic intruders, like silverfish or vermins, make use of openings and conditions but do not always nest in your home. Each classification requires a various strategy, and a good pest control company will customize the plan accordingly.

When I walked a 1920s cottage with a new property owner that kept hearing faint rustling during the night, the first specialist she called proposed a perennial basic solution, regular monthly gos to, and a rodent lure terminal package for the outside. He never ever climbed into the attic. A competitor invested fifteen mins with a headlamp in the eaves, then revealed us a two-inch space at the fascia and numerous droppings along the knee wall. The second service provider secured the entrance factor, set traps in details runway locations, removed the carcasses, and adhered to up twice. This work cost less than 2 months of the first strategy and ended the problem within a week. Good pest control starts with assessment, not with exterminator a sales script.

What a reliable inspection looks like

If the very first check out lasts five mins and finishes with a laminated rate sheet, keep looking. An appropriate assessment has a rhythm. Outdoors, a service technician circles around the foundation, downspouts, and plants clearance, checking for helpful problems such as wood-to-soil contact, wet compost against house siding, and voids at energy infiltrations. Indoors, they comply with moisture and heat. Kitchens, shower rooms, laundry room, cellar sills, and attic room ventilation all get a look. They may ask to relocate the oven cabinet or look under a sink base. If rodents are believed, they look for rub marks, droppings, and munch points at door corners. For termites, they try to find shelter tubes, blistered paint, or soft areas in walls. For bed insects, they peel back joints and examine tufts.

A skilled exterminator narrates as they go, even if briefly. You will hear remarks like, "These droppings are consistent with computer mice, not rats," or "These wings are termite swarmer wings, see the equal size." They might make use of a wetness meter on suspicious timber or a flashlight at ground level to detect ants routing during the warm of the day. The devices do not require to be fancy. Interest issues greater than equipment.

Credentials that actually matter

Licensing and insurance coverage are the bare minimum. You desire a pest control company that holds the proper state licenses for architectural pest control and, when called for, a different license for bed pest or termite treatments. Ask to see evidence of general responsibility and workers' payment insurance policy. I have seen attic room joists broken by a reckless step, overspray on a truck, and ladder dents in gutters. Insurance coverage exists due to the fact that crashes happen.

Beyond licensing, look for evidence of continuing education and learning. In many states, technicians need a number of CEUs annually to keep their credential. When a firm buys training, you see it in the field decisions. During a heat wave one summer season, I viewed a tech swap out a liquid ant lure for a gel because the swarm had moved to healthy protein. That choice comes from technique and training.

Experience by pest kind matters greater than years in business. A more recent pest control contractor that treats bed pests once a week usually exceeds a large exterminator company that sends a generalist two times a year. Ask, "The number of bed bug work have you completed this year? What is your re-treatment price? What are the usual reasons when they fall short?" Listen for details numbers or ranges and honest explanations.

The strategy need to match the bug, the structure, and your tolerance

A respectable exterminator service will certainly propose an integrated strategy. You may hear the acronym IPM, integrated bug management. Water, food, and harborage reduction precede. Chemical controls, when used, are exact and targeted.

For rodents, a good strategy begins with exclusion. Seal quarter-sized openings for computer mice, larger for rats, with steel wool and caulk or equipment towel. Traps within, bait terminals outside where enabled, and cleanliness steps like sealed pet dog food go hand in hand. If a proposal leans on poison inside living rooms without a plan to get rid of carcasses or seal access points, that is careless and short-sighted.

For cockroaches, cleanliness and accessibility matter as long as chemical option. I when dealt with a restaurant that cut German roach counts by 80 percent in three weeks just by shutting floor drain voids with stainless inserts and including nightly wipe-down methods. The pest control company switched over to a turning of development regulatory authorities and baits, applied as pin-sized droplets, not broadcast sprays. The mix stuck because the setting changed.

For termites, the decision often boils down to soil treatments versus baits. A fluid termiticide develops a cured zone that termites can not cross. It offers instant security but calls for drilling and trenching. Lure systems, such as those set up around the perimeter, can get rid of colonies in time and are much less invasive, however they need monitoring and patience. A great exterminator outlines both paths with pros, cons, and expenses, then points to conditions on your building that tip the decision. Heavy clay dirt, high water tables, piece construction, or historical brick can all affect the treatment choice.

For bed bugs, warmth, chemical, or integrated approaches all work when performed well. Whole-home warm therapies get to dangerous temperature levels for a sustained time. They need preparation, remove chemical residues, and can be expensive. Chemical treatments with cautious fracture and hole applications and dusting in gaps set you back much less but require multiple check outs. A firm that supplies both, or that companions with a specialist, is normally more flexible and honest regarding compromises.

Price, value, and the expense of cheap promises

Pricing differs by region and infestation. For a normal single-family home, general pest control may run 300 to 600 bucks annually for quarterly solution. Bed pest tasks often vary from 750 to 2,500 dollars depending upon areas and method. Termite lure systems can begin near 800 to 1,500 dollars for mount, plus yearly monitoring fees, while dirt therapies for a mid-sized home might run 1,200 to 2,500 bucks. Rodent exclusion can differ wildly, from a few hundred for securing tiny voids to several thousand for heavy structural work.

The lowest quote can be a trap. Here are the inquiries I ask when two propositions are much apart:

    What precisely is consisted of in the initial service and the follow-ups? The amount of brows through and on what schedule? Which items or approaches will certainly you make use of, at what areas, and why those over alternatives? What conditions do you need me to address, and how will we confirm that each side did their part? What does your assurance promise and omit, and just how do I ask for a retreat? Who will certainly be my continuous professional, and just how do I reach them in between visits?

If the reduced bid includes fewer brows through, much less tracking, or no range for exclusion, it is not apples to apples. Often, a higher bid covers fixings, securing, and hygiene tools that avoid persisting prices. On one multifamily home, a business suggested adhesive catches and regular monthly spray downs for computer mice. Another bid was 40 percent greater and included securing 35 infiltrations, setting up door moves, and getting rid of the dumpster overflow. The 2nd plan decreased call-backs by 90 percent within two months, and the total year price was lower.

Red flags that predict headaches

Most issues I have actually seen after the reality were predictable from the very first contact. Business that guarantee a long-term fix to an open environment trouble, like mice in a city rowhouse with falling apart mortar, are offering hope, not a service. Assurances that consist of numerous exclusions, such as "no insurance coverage for re-infestation from bordering units," are not always bad, yet they need to be clarified, not concealed behind small print. If a sales representative resists listing information, prevent them. If a professional hesitates to reveal you product labels or security information sheets upon demand, keep your budget in your pocket.

Beware of one-size-fits-all quarterly strategies that assert to cover every little thing without any inspection charges or attachments. When you check out the contract, you might find that bed pests, termites, pest control wildlife, and German roaches are omitted. That sort of plan has its place, especially for seasonal ants or occasional spiders, yet it will certainly not assist with high-pressure pests.

Another warning sign is overspray or unneeded wide applications. If you see a technician fogging the walls in every area for ants, they are treating the symptom, not the reason. The colony is outside. That chemical does little more than leave residue where your kids and pet dogs live. You desire targeted baits, split and gap applications behind switch plates, or border perimeter therapies that address the trail, not inside fogging for show.

Contracts and guarantees that indicate something

A great warranty has clear triggers and solutions. It must mention the covered insects, the length of time insurance coverage lasts, what re-treatments price, and what activities void the warranty. For termites, you will see repair service guarantees, retreat-only guarantees, or crossbreed versions. Repair warranties can be valuable if you trust the firm's longevity and their process, however they are typically a lot more pricey. Retreat-only can be perfectly fine if you check each year and maintain a record of tidy inspections.

Read for transferability and cancellation terms. If you intend to sell within a couple of years, a transferable termite bond can help the sale. On the other hand, some basic pest control agreements auto-renew with tight termination charges. If you see early discontinuation penalties that surpass the rest of the solution worth, bargain or walk.

Payment terms inform you concerning a firm's confidence. Sensible deposits for significant job are normal. Complete early repayment for unrendered solutions is not, unless a discount rate compensates and you rely on the carrier. For bed bugs, vendors sometimes phase settlements throughout check outs, which aligns incentives.

Safety and environmental factors to consider without the slogans

Homeowners frequently request "green" services. The term is unclear. What matters is direct exposure, not marketing language. The best pest control decreases the requirement for chemicals through exemption and hygiene, then uses the least-toxic effective product in the smallest quantity, in one of the most targeted location, for the fastest time. That could be a desiccant dirt in a wall gap, a gel bait under a kitchen counter lip, or a development regulatory authority in a drainpipe. For insects, it could be larvicide in standing water and a fixed grade for runoff.

Ask the specialist to walk you with the items they intend to use. Review the energetic ingredients on the tag, not simply the trade name. If you have pet dogs, aquariums, or kids with bronchial asthma, say so early. Good business note those information in your data and adjust solutions and application approaches. I have actually seen service technicians swap out pyrethroids near aquarium or stay clear of aerosol providers near oxygen equipment. These are little changes that make a large difference.

Ventilation after treatment is normally uncomplicated. Easy open-window timeframes, frequently 30 to 60 mins, are enough for several indoor applications. For warm treatments, they will certainly set the time and surveillance equipment. For sulfuryl fluoride fumigations, which are rare for single-family homes outside of particular termite or whole-structure scenarios, the safety and security procedures are stringent, with clear re-entry times. If your provider seems informal concerning re-entry, that is a concern.

Comparing bids: a sensible way to line them up

Paperwork from pest control business is infamously difficult to contrast. One checklists every chemical with percent strengths, one more provides a pleasant recap concerning "multi-point protection," and the third gives a single number and a signature line. Produce a straightforward grid on your own. Compose pest type, therapy technique, variety of check outs, consisted of fixings or securing, monitoring timetable, assurance terms, complete cost, and optional add-ons. Call each vendor back and fill up in any blanks.

During the callback, listen to how they handle your questions. Do they obtain protective or helpful? Do they send out modified ranges in composing? I dealt with a residential property supervisor that picked suppliers based on their responsiveness during this stage, not just reward or references. The reasoning was audio. If they connect clearly when trying to gain your organization, they will possibly do so during service.

When wildlife slips right into the picture

Not every pest control service deals with wild animals. Squirrels in the attic room, raccoons in the soffit, or bats in the smokeshaft need a different certificate in several states and a various ability. Wildlife control concentrates on humane trapping, one-way doors, and fixing of access points, typically complied with by sanitizing infected insulation. If you believe wildlife, ask straight whether the exterminator company has that capability or partners with a wild animals expert. A basic pest control professional who establishes a few traps without sealing accessibility factors will certainly create a cycle of return gos to without resolution.

What readiness appears like on your side

Clients affect outcomes. A tidy, easily accessible, and well-prepared home allows professionals to bring their ideal job. For cockroaches, bag and get rid of the pantry products the night prior to so they can access voids and joints. For bed bugs, follow the prep list exactly, yet beware of over-prepping. Getting every item and relocating little furnishings throughout rooms can spread insects. A good company will offer details, measured guidelines such as laundering bed linen on high warmth, decluttering under beds, and leaving furnishings in place for proper treatment.

In services, coordinating access and holding both renter and landlord answerable matters as long as treatment option. In one structure with repeating cockroach problems, the manager created prep directions in three languages, added picture-based guides on exactly how to empty cupboards, and sent out a team member the day before to assist senior locals lift light items. Therapy efficiency improved by half without transforming chemicals.

The duty of innovation without the buzzwords

Remote monitors, smart traps, and electronic reporting have actually made pest control less complicated to validate. I do not employ a service provider for gizmos, but I value business that record what they did, where, and when. An easy image of a sealed space, a map of lure stations with service days, or a log of catch checks informs me the plan was performed. Some carriers offer client portals with solution records and item labels. That transparency helps when personnel change or when you offer the property.

Seasonality, local peculiarities, and unique cases

Pest pressure is not consistent. In the Southeast, fire ants and below ground termites use constant stress. In the Southwest, scorpions and roofing rats create various patterns. In the Northeast, rodents rise in fall as temperature levels drop. High altitude communities see collection flies gather on south-facing walls in late summertime. Your selection of pest control company need to mirror neighborhood experience. Ask what seasonal insects they expect and just how they adjust routines. A quarterly schedule might shift to bi-monthly during peak months and two times a year in wintertime, or the contrary for certain pests.

For historic homes, permeable stone structures and balloon framing make complex exclusion. You may require a contractor that comprehends how to secure without stifling, exactly how to protect ventilation while blocking access, and exactly how to treat timber participants sensitively. For green roofing systems or pollinator gardens, you desire a team that can secure beneficial bugs while resolving pests that threaten individuals and structures.

References and reputation that go deeper than celebrity ratings

Online examines assistance, but they squash nuance. Search for patterns over years, not just a high rating last month. A firm with hundreds of evaluations across five or more years and comprehensive comments concerning particular parasites is a much safer wager than a handful of glowing notes that sound like advertising and marketing. Ask for two referrals for the parasite you are managing. When you call, ask what went wrong initially, then ask exactly how the firm reacted. Truthful companies make blunders, and the means they recoup informs you more than excellence claims.

Local residential property supervisors, dining establishment proprietors, and home assessors can be candid sources. They see technicians functioning when there is no sales pitch. If numerous pros point out the same name with regard, pay attention.

When national chains versus regional operators is not the genuine question

Large exterminator business bring standardization, deeper bench toughness, and usually quicker emergency situation response. Regional pest control professionals bring adaptability, connections, and occasionally sharper rates. I have actually hired both. The much better inquiry is fit. Does the certain branch or proprietor have the service technician top quality, pest experience, and solution society your circumstance demands? Several of the best termite treatments I have actually seen were from little firms that deal with thousands of homes per year in one region. A few of the best multi-site rodent programs originated from nationwide companies with data-driven scheduling and specialized account managers. Stay clear of stereotypes and judge the team that will in fact offer you.

A portable checklist for your final choice

    Verify licenses, insurance coverage, and experience with your certain bug, and request current task matters and re-treatment rates. Evaluate the assessment high quality: time on website, areas examined, findings clarified, and images or notes provided. Compare composed scopes: approaches, products, check out matters, included exclusion or fixings, and monitoring frequency. Understand guarantees and contracts: covered parasites, period, remedies, exclusions, renewal and cancellation terms. Assess communication: responsiveness, clarity in responses, determination to tailor, and documents practices.

What is the hardest pest to get rid of?

Bed bugs are widely considered among the hardest pests to eliminate because they hide in very small cracks and can survive many common treatments. German cockroaches are also difficult due to rapid reproduction and increasing resistance to certain insecticides. Termites can be challenging because colonies may be hidden inside structures or underground. Rodents can be persistent when entry points and food sources are not fully addressed.

What kind of pest control is cheapest?

The cheapest approach is usually prevention and exclusion, such as sealing entry points and reducing food and water sources. For active pests, basic traps or baits for common insects or rodents are typically lower cost than full-structure or specialty treatments. Costs rise when the pest requires multiple visits, specialized equipment, or whole-home treatment methods. Cheaper methods can be less effective if the underlying entry or harborage problem remains.

How to 100% get rid of mice?

A guaranteed “100%” outcome is not realistic without ongoing prevention because mice can re-enter if access and attractants remain. The most effective approach is integrated: seal entry points, remove food sources, and use traps or professionally placed baits based on activity patterns. Success is measured by no new droppings, no sounds, and no trap activity over time. Continued monitoring is necessary because a small missed entry point can restart the problem.

What are three signs that you have a rat infestation?

Common signs include rodent droppings, gnaw marks on wood/plastic/wiring, and scratching or scurrying sounds in walls or ceilings. You may also see greasy rub marks along baseboards where rats travel repeatedly. Nests made from shredded paper or insulation can indicate active harborage. Fresh droppings and new gnawing typically suggest current activity rather than an old problem.

Is it possible to 100% get rid of bed bugs?

Complete elimination is possible, but “100% guaranteed” is difficult because bed bugs hide in tiny spaces and can be reintroduced via luggage, furniture, or adjacent units. Effective eradication typically requires a combination of methods such as heat treatment and targeted insecticides, plus strict follow-up. Multiple visits are common because eggs may survive an initial treatment. Ongoing monitoring is used to confirm the infestation is gone.

What are signs you need an exterminator?

Signs include repeated sightings of live pests, droppings, persistent bites or skin reactions consistent with pests, and property damage such as gnawed wires or chewed materials. Recurring problems after DIY treatments often indicate the source is not being addressed. Unusual odors, nests, or persistent noises in walls can suggest hidden infestations. Professional identification matters because treatments differ by species and behavior.

What is the most effective pest control?

The most effective approach is integrated pest management (IPM), which combines inspection, sanitation, exclusion, targeted treatment, and ongoing monitoring. Effectiveness comes from removing the conditions that allow pests to survive, not only killing visible pests. Targeted methods (baits, growth regulators, exclusion, and limited-use sprays) are selected based on the pest’s biology and entry points. Long-term results depend on preventing re-entry and reducing food, water, and shelter.
